Transaction 20aa3fc8053fb7875f05626288001337e803a0e77ca348d2024dff81d7320e86

2 Input
2 Outputs
  • 20aa3fc8053fb7875f05626288001337e803a0e77ca348d2024dff81d7320e86:0
  • value  3780000000
    address  16Qi7p5tqER46ThspaPib1tm4N2WbCdz5n
  • 20aa3fc8053fb7875f05626288001337e803a0e77ca348d2024dff81d7320e86:1
  • value  9001832995
    address  3BMEXW6iZfN3D5tDTMwhWgjCsxUuHHc51c